While these aren\u2019t the absolute all-time low prices we have tracked for the Pixel 10 lineup, they still represent a huge discount on Google\u2019s most cutting-edge smartphone hardware and remain incredible deals.<\/p>\n<p class=\"bodytext\">Here is the complete list of Pixel 10 series configurations currently on sale:<\/p>\n<p>Which Pixel 10 model should you buy?<\/p>\n<p class=\"bodytext\">The <a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Google-Pixel-10-Pro-XL-Smartphone-Review-Gorgeous-flagship-that-offers-a-great-Android-experience-with-one-Achilles-heel.1100253.0.html\" target=\"_self\" class=\"internal-link\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Pixel 10 Pro XL<\/a> is a standout value at $899 and is the one to pick if you like the bigger phones. It is the powerhouse of the group, boasting a massive 6.8-inch 24-bit LTPO OLED display with a 120Hz variable refresh rate and a blinding 3,300 nits peak HDR brightness. You get an impressive triple camera system\u2014a 50MP primary shooter, a 48MP telephoto lens with 5x optical zoom, and a 48MP ultra-wide lens\u2014backed by a large 5,200mAh battery supporting 45W wired and 25W wireless charging.<\/p>\n<p class=\"bodytext\">The <a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Google-Pixel-10-Pro-Smartphone-Review-Compact-AI-monster-with-top-cameras.1129342.0.html\" target=\"_self\" class=\"internal-link\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Pixel 10 Pro<\/a> at $250 off is also a solid deal. You\u2019re not missing out much in terms of raw performance or features, either. It\u2019s nearly identical to the XL but offers a more pocket-friendly form factor, with a petite 6.3-inch panel and the flagship triple-camera array. But you do have to settle for a smaller 4,870mAh battery and comparatively slower charging speeds, though\u2014wired charging tops out at 30W while the wireless magnetic charging can reach 15W max.<\/p>\n<p class=\"bodytext\">Finally, the standard Pixel 10 is an excellent entry point at just $599. While it drops the RAM from 16GB to 12GB, it still features a versatile camera setup consisting of a 48MP main camera, a 10.8MP telephoto lens with 5x optical zoom, and a 13MP ultra-wide shooter.<\/p>\n<p class=\"bodytext\">Except for the camera hardware, battery capacities, charging speeds, and screen sizes, all three phones offer the same set of software features and performance, featuring Google\u2019s powerful <a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Google-Tensor-G5-Processor-Benchmarks-and-Specs.1100879.0.html\" target=\"_self\" class=\"internal-link\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Tensor G5 chipset,<\/a> which powers AI features like Magic Cue, Voice Translate, and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Google-Pixel-10-Pro-What-does-the-camera-coach-offer.1128380.0.html\" target=\"_self\" class=\"internal-link\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Camera Coach<\/a>, along with seven years of guaranteed OS updates.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Notebookcheck-Team.212978.0.html?&amp;tx_nbc2journalist_pi1%5Bmode%5D=show&amp;tx_nbc2journalist_pi1%5Buid%5D=386\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ie\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/csm_Kristen_Spradlin_profile_image_Dec_2024_JPEG_45f1d67002.jpg\" loading=\"lazy\" width=\"120\" height=\"120\" alt=\"Kristen Spradlin\"\/><\/a><a href=\"https:\/\/www.notebookcheck.net\/Notebookcheck-Team.212978.0.html?&amp;tx_nbc2journalist_pi1%5Bmode%5D=show&amp;tx_nbc2journalist_pi1%5Buid%5D=386\" class=\"j_name\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Kristen Spradlin<\/a> &#8211; Tech Writer  &#8211; 174 articles published on Notebookcheck since 2024<\/p>\n<p>Kristen is a technology writer based in Toronto.
